For those who are just beginning to consider starting a venture or want to take their organization to the next level, this book offers advice on what works and what doesn't.Like many business owners, Susan-Urquhart Brown never expected to end up as an entrepreneur. Launching her own business spoke to her passions, but she soon realized there was much more to being a successful owner than she ever expected.In The Accidental Entrepreneur, she takes all the mystery out of going solo. With hard-won wisdom and empathy, she shows you: the 8 questions everyone should ask up frontthe top 10 traits of the successful entrepreneurhow to obtain a license and sellers permitthe best way to create a business plan10 simple ways to get referralsthe 6 secrets of marketing a businesssmart tips for investing and financeways to avoid burnouthow to avoid the 7 biggest pitfalls in businessStarting one's own business should be exciting, not scary. The Accidental Entrepreneur shows you how to create a successful and fulfilling venture they can be proud of.
